§ 108D-30 — Intent and Goals

It is the intent of the General Assembly to transform the State's current Medicaid program in order to provide budget predictability for the taxpayers of this State while ensuring quality care to those in need. The new Medicaid program shall be designed to achieve the following goals:
(1)Ensure budget predictability through shared risk and accountability.
(2)Ensure balanced quality, patient satisfaction, and financial measures.
(3)Ensure efficient and cost-effective administrative systems and structures.
(4)Ensure a sustainable delivery system. (2015-245, s. 1; 2019-81, s. 14(a); 2022-74, s. 9D.15(z); 2023-11, s. 3.2(e).)
